About the Business

A B&B at Llewellyn Lodge is a charming lodging establishment located at 603 South Main Street in the historic town of Lexington, Virginia, United States. This cozy bed and breakfast offers comfortable accommodations in a peaceful setting, perfect for a relaxing getaway. The lodge is known for its warm hospitality, delicious home-cooked breakfasts, and convenient location near local attractions such as the Virginia Military Institute and Washington and Lee University. Guests can enjoy a tranquil stay in beautifully decorated rooms, each with its own unique charm. Whether you are visiting for a romantic weekend or exploring the scenic Shenandoah Valley, A B&B at Llewellyn Lodge is the perfect choice for your stay in Lexington.
